BrianC wrote:Thanks for the help Hammy, just one question if I could on the CMT modifier for IC. I thought I read somewhere that you only get that if the IC is physically with the BG being influenced on the CMT, is that right? Or can an IC influence a BG within 12 MU and claim the +1 modifier for being an IC? Other than that I think I am on board finally.
An IC can add 2 to a BGs CMT or cohesion test up to his full 12 MU command radius as long as the BG is not in close combat and the IC is not fighting in the front rank.
